MUNDOSAP

MUNDOSAP (foro/index.php)
-   Programación ABAP IV (foro/forumdisplay.php?f=4)
-   -   Batch input. Reemplazo Tx sm35 (foro/showthread.php?t=35798)

gdmj1107 22/03/10 21:59:27

Batch input. Reemplazo Tx sm35
 
Hola a todos, les comento que tengo desarrollado un batch input para realizar salida de mercancias con nro de serie. El problema radica en que cada vez que debe ejecutarse este proceso se tienen aproximadamente unos 400 archivos planos.

Ustedes se imaginaran el trabajo de la persona que opera el proceso, primero para crear el juego de datos y luego para usar la tx sm35.

El desarrollo utiliza la funcion UPLOAD, de manera que el proceso es interactivo.
Lo que requiero es leer en forma automática los 400 archivos planos, creando los juegos de datos respectivos en forma secuencial, mejor si es en proceso de fondo, sin que se realize una inteaccion para cada archivo plano. Luego lanzar estos juegos de datos tambien en forma secuencial para que se puedan ejecutar.

He visto que existe una aplicacion que la estaba probando y que es la RSBDCSUB que reemplaza a la sm35, pero mi problema es que tengo mas de un juego de datos. He probado utilizar un nombre de juego de datos que use una denominacion comun, pero todos los juegos de datos son lanzados al mismo tiempo y como yo debo realizar la salida de los mismos materiales en diferentes fechas, un proceso bloquea al otro.

Yo quiero evitar este bloqueo por uso del codigo del material y para esto lo ideal sería que primero se ejecute un juego de datos y al concluir este lo haga el próximo etc. Pero no encuentro la manera de hacerlo.

He intentado realizar el proceso con bapis, pero el proceso es muy lento al realizar el commit, lo que me indica que esta opción no es la más optima.

Agradezco anticipadamente su ayuda

Gracias.

temaljose 22/03/10 23:20:27

buenas, amigo has un "open_group" con el primer archivo y hasta no terminar con el ultimo archivo no hagas el "close_group", de esta forma te generara un solo juego de datos, luego lo puedes ejecutar con el programa RSBDCSUB, saludos


Husos Horarios son GMT. La hora en este momento es 21:09:03.

www.mundosap.com 2006 - Spain
software crm, crm on demand, software call center, crm act, crm solutions, crm gratis, crm web